On Wed, Jul 24, 2024 at 06:48:36PM +0200, Larysa Zaremba wrote:
> Locking used in ice_qp_ena() and ice_qp_dis() does pretty much nothing,
> because ICE_CFG_BUSY is a state flag that is supposed to be set in a PF
> state, not VSI one. Therefore it does not protect the queue pair from
> e.g. reset.
> 
> Despite being useless, it still can deadlock the unfortunate functions that
> have fell into the same ICE_CFG_BUSY-VSI trap. This happens if ice_qp_ena
> returns an error.
> 
> Remove ICE_CFG_BUSY locking from ice_qp_dis() and ice_qp_ena().

Why not just check the pf->state ? And address other broken callsites?
